Claims (15)

  1. Kochvorrichtung zum Kochen in der Mikrowelle, umfassend ein anorganisches Bindemittel und eine Kupferschlacke, dadurch gekennzeichnet, dass die Vorrichtung 10 Gew.-% bis 45 Gew.-% Kupferschlacke umfasst und die Porosität des Materials, gemessen gemäß UNI EN ISO 10545-3:2000, im Bereich von 1 % bis 15 % liegt.
  2. Kochvorrichtung nach Anspruch 1, bei der die Menge an Kupferschlacke im Bereich von 15 bis 35 Gew.-%, vorzugsweise 20 bis 30 Gew.-% liegt.
  3. Kochvorrichtung nach Anspruch 1 oder 2, wobei die Menge an Kupferschlacke im Bereich von 24 bis 26 Gew.-% liegt.
  4. Kochvorrichtung nach einem der Ansprüche 1 bis 3, wobei der Porositätswert, gemessen gemäß UNI EN ISO 10545-3:2000, im Bereich von 2 % bis 12 %, vorzugsweise 2 % bis 6 %, liegt.
  5. Kochvorrichtung nach einem der vorhergehenden Ansprüche, ferner umfassend eine Metallschicht, die sich auf der Innenseite der Vorrichtung befindet, einschließlich Seitenwände, wenn diese vorhanden sind.
  6. Kochvorrichtung nach einem der vorhergehenden Ansprüche, wobei die Kochvorrichtung einen Basisteil und einen Deckelteil aufweist.
  7. Kochvorrichtung nach Anspruch 6, wobei sich die prozentuale Menge an Schlacke in dem Deckelteil von der prozentualen Menge an Schlacke in dem Basisteil unterscheidet.
  8. Kochvorrichtung nach einem der vorhergehenden Ansprüche, wobei das anorganische Bindemittel ausgewählt ist aus Terrakotta, halb-feuerfesten Materialien, feuerfesten Materialien mit niedrigem Schmelzpunkt, atomisierter Keramik, Ton, Kaolin, Feldspat und anorganischen Mischungen, die zur Herstellung von Tonwaren, Steingut, Steinzeug und Keramik geeignet sind, einem Material mit hoher Plastizität für Feinsteinzeug, vorzugsweise für Porcelaingres.
  9. Kochvorrichtung nach Anspruch 8, wobei die Vorrichtung aus einem Material hergestellt ist, das zur Herstellung eines Porcelaingres geeignet ist und eine Porosität im Bereich von 2 bis 6 % aufweist.
  10. Verfahren zur Herstellung einer Kochvorrichtung nach einem der Ansprüche 1 bis 9, wobei eine Kupferschlacke mit einem anorganischen Bindemittel gemischt, zu einer gewünschten Kochvorrichtung geformt und gebrannt wird, dadurch gekennzeichnet, dass die Menge an mit dem anorganischen Bindemittel vermischter Kupferschlacke im Bereich von 10 Gew.-% bis 45 Gew.-% liegt und die geformte Vorrichtung bei einer Temperatur unterhalb von 1180 °C gebrannt wird, um eine Porosität gemäß Anspruch 1 bereitzustellen.
  11. Verfahren nach Anspruch 10, wobei die Brenntemperatur im Bereich von 950 °C bis 1160 °C, vorzugsweise von 1100 °C bis 1140 °C, mehr bevorzugt von 1130 °C bis 1140 °C liegt.
  12. Nahrungsmittelbehälter, der ein anorganisches Bindemittel und eine Kupferschlacke umfasst, dadurch gekennzeichnet, dass die Menge der Schlacke im Bereich von 3 bis 10 Gew.-% liegt, wobei vorzugsweise 10 % ausgeschlossen sind.
  13. Nahrungsmittelbehälter nach Anspruch 12, wobei das anorganische Bindemittel ausgewählt ist aus Terrakotta, halb-feuerfesten Materialien, feuerfesten Materialien mit niedrigem Schmelzpunkt, atomisierter Keramik, Ton, Kaolin, Feldspat und anorganischen Mischungen, die zur Herstellung von Tonwaren, Steingut, Steinzeug und Keramik geeignet sind.
  14. Nahrungsmittelbehälter nach Anspruch 13, wobei das anorganische Bindemittel ein Material mit hoher Plastizität für Feinsteinzeug, vorzugsweise für Porcelaingres, ist.
  15. Lebensmittelbehälter nach Anspruch 13 oder 14, der ausgewählt ist aus Tellern, Servierplatten, Geschirr, Schüsseln und Geschirr.
